Description

It is with great delight that John Alan have been appointed the sole agents in the sale of this superb three bedroomed ground floor self-contained converted flat.  Occupying the whole of the ground floor in an Edwardian semi-detached house and an extended area.  This spacious flat will appeal to first time buyers.  Among the benefits to note these include own front entrance door, very long lease, own private garden, many original features, close to amenities, no chain.

Entrance: Via double doors leading to porch, tessellated flooring, leading to own multi-glazed front entrance door with side lights in leaded light and stained glass, original flooring, covered radiator, cornice ceiling, picture rail, spacious L-shaped hallway with ornate original fireplace, fretwork arch, cupboard housing meters.

Lounge: 17'0 x 12'0 (open plan to kitchen), laminate flooring, feature fireplace with tiled inset, cornice ceiling, picture rail, two double radiators, ample power points.

Kitchen: 11'5 x 10'6 Double glazed doors to garden, range of wall, base and larder units with inset sink unit and mixer taps, worktops with post formed edges, built-in Beko oven and hob plus Bosch extractor hood, plumbing for washing machine and dishwasher, partly tiled, tiled splashbacks, boiler for central heating, skylight, ample power points.

Bedroom 1: 17'1 x 14'4 Angled bay double glazed window to front, two double radiators, laminate flooring, feature fireplace with tiled inset, coved ceiling, picture rail, Ideal combi boiler.

En-Suite: Opaque double glazed window to side, shower cubicle, fully tiled, low level WC, vanity wash hand basin, laminate flooring.

Bedroom 2: 12'0 x 8'5 Opaque double glazed window to side, burrowed light window to bedroom 3, laminate flooring, double radiator, ample power points.

Bedroom 3: 10'6 x 8'5 Double glazed window to rear, fitted carpet, double radiator, skylight, ample power points.

Shower Room: Comprising double shower, large vanity wash hand basin, mostly tiled, tiled flooring, heat rail.

WC: Low level system, small wash basin, laminate flooring.

Front Garden: OSP to the front for one car (right hand side from the road).
 
Rear Garden: Approx. 60'0 (sole use of).  Mainly laid to lawn, flower borders, small patio area, fully decked pathway, veg patch, pear tree.

Tenure: Leasehold.

Length of Lease: 999 years from December 2023.

Service Charge: Ad hoc.

Ground Rent: Peppercorn.

Council Tax Band: C.
